## Query planner regression

Since the Orvel 4.2 upgrade, joins on `shipment_events` pick a sequential scan. Review any PR touching planner hints in `plans/overrides.sql`. Confirm `EXPLAIN ANALYZE` shows index usage before approving. Reproduce locally against the frozen snapshot; restore it first, then connect using the string below.

replica DSN, kajep-yahag: mssql://praok_svc:iF@db-8d68.plorvaio.local:5432/eliion

Hey, welcome aboard! Quick heads-up on the Tonepress CI pipeline: the waveform preview step in the audio-render job sometimes fails because the headless renderer on the Quillbank runners can't allocate a canvas. If you see a blank PNG in the artifacts, rerun with the software-rasterizer flag before filing anything. Marza fixed the flaky font dependency last sprint, so that's not it anymore. When it still breaks, grab the token below and ping the pipeline channel with it.

pipeline stamp: htk14_378fd70323001d

16:05 — The Lanefinder address autocomplete widget on the Brindlewick checkout page began returning empty suggestion lists after a schema change in the upstream locality index. Users could still type addresses manually, so checkout completion dipped but did not stop. The widget team shipped a compatibility shim at 17:40 and suggestions recovered. For context while you onboard, the degraded period maps to the deployment token below.

session token of tajef-bageg = htk21_5d90d574934f3ccae6437

## Authentication

Hey future maintainer! The Stockgrove reconciliation job runs nightly and compares warehouse counts against the Tallyfern ledger. It authenticates to the internal ledger API with a static service key — yes, we know, rotation is on the roadmap. The key the job currently uses is pasted right below here.

gateway credential: kto11_pTkcHgLwuNE